Sarah has a strong foundation in venture capital and a growing practice in mergers and acquisitions.
She advises clients—particularly in the technology and life sciences sectors—on a broad range of corporate and transactional matters, including early- and late-stage investments, strategic financings, and cross-border transactions. Her experience spans both private practice and in-house roles, including a secondment with an impact investment fund where she led investments across Latin America, Africa, and the U.S., and trained legal teams on venture documentation and financial modelling.
 
Sarah has worked with clients across multiple jurisdictions and sectors, including financial services, healthcare, and industrials. She brings a collaborative and commercially minded approach to complex legal issues. 
 
She is also committed to pro bono work, having partnered with legal aid organisations in Greece and the U.S. to support refugee and immigrant communities. With over five years of experience, Sarah is recognised for her attention to detail, cross-cultural fluency, and ability to deliver practical, business-oriented advice.

Representative matters

  • Oakley Capital on $1 billion sale of its portfolio company, vLex, a leading LegalTech platform, to Clio, a global leader in legal technology head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
  • Khosla Ventures on its $17 million investment in a private company leading in procurement automation.
